    After undergoing a breast lift in Montclair, it's crucial to follow specific post-operative care guidelines to ensure optimal recovery and results. Here are some key things to avoid:

    1. Strenuous Activities: Avoid heavy lifting, vigorous exercise, and any activities that could strain your chest muscles for at least four to six weeks. This helps prevent complications and promotes proper healing.

    2. Exposure to Sun: Direct sunlight can affect the healing process and cause discoloration of the scars. Use a high-SPF sunscreen and wear protective clothing if you need to be outdoors.

    3. Smoking and Alcohol: Both smoking and alcohol consumption can hinder the healing process. Smoking reduces blood flow, which can delay recovery, while alcohol can interfere with medications and increase the risk of complications.

    4. Skipping Follow-Ups: Regular follow-up appointments with your surgeon are essential. These visits allow your doctor to monitor your progress and address any concerns promptly.

    5. Ignoring Pain or Discomfort: While some discomfort is normal, persistent pain or unusual symptoms should be reported to your surgeon immediately. This could indicate an issue that needs attention.

    6. Underestimating Scar Care: Proper scar care is vital. Avoid picking at stitches or scabs, and follow your surgeon's instructions on how to care for your incisions to minimize scarring.

    By adhering to these guidelines, you can enhance your chances of a smooth recovery and achieve the best possible outcome from your breast lift procedure in Montclair.

    After undergoing a breast lift procedure, it's crucial to follow specific guidelines to ensure optimal recovery and results. One of the key aspects to avoid is engaging in activities that could compromise the healing process. Here are some professional recommendations:

    Firstly, avoid any strenuous physical activities or heavy lifting for at least four to six weeks post-surgery. This includes exercises like weightlifting, running, or any activity that significantly elevates your heart rate. Engaging in such activities too soon can strain the healing tissues and potentially lead to complications.

    Secondly, steer clear of exposing your incisions to direct sunlight. UV rays can cause hyperpigmentation and delay the healing process. Always use a high-SPF sunscreen and cover up with clothing if you need to be outdoors.

    Additionally, avoid wearing underwire bras immediately after the procedure. Opt for soft, supportive bras that do not put pressure on the incisions. This will help in reducing discomfort and promoting proper healing.

    Lastly, avoid smoking and consuming alcohol, as both can impede blood flow and hinder the healing process. Maintaining a healthy lifestyle with a balanced diet and adequate hydration will support your body's natural healing abilities.

    By adhering to these guidelines, you can ensure a smoother recovery and achieve the best possible outcome from your breast lift procedure. Always consult with your surgeon for personalized advice tailored to your specific situation.
